What Features Should You Look for in a Best Lawn Mowing Shoe?

When searching for the best lawn mowing shoe, consider the following features:

  • Durability: Look for shoes made from high-quality materials that can withstand the rigors of outdoor use. A durable shoe will resist wear and tear from grass, dirt, and potential impacts from objects in the yard.
  • Comfort: Comfort is essential, especially if you spend long hours mowing the lawn. Shoes with cushioned insoles and proper arch support help prevent fatigue and discomfort during extended use.
  • Slip Resistance: A good lawn mowing shoe should have a slip-resistant outsole to provide traction on wet or uneven surfaces. This feature helps prevent slips and falls, ensuring safety while mowing.
  • Water Resistance: Shoes with water-resistant properties keep your feet dry in dewy grass or unexpected rain. This feature also helps in maintaining the integrity of the shoe material over time.
  • Breathability: Look for shoes that offer good ventilation to keep your feet cool and dry. Breathable materials help to wick away moisture and prevent overheating during warm weather.
  • Lightweight Construction: Lightweight shoes reduce fatigue, making them ideal for mowing tasks. A lighter shoe allows for better maneuverability and comfort while walking and operating the mower.
  • Easy to Clean: Lawn mowing can be a messy job, so shoes that are easy to clean are beneficial. Materials that can be wiped down or are machine washable will save you time and effort after mowing.

What Role Does Traction Play in Choosing Lawn Mowing Shoes?

Traction is a crucial factor when selecting the best lawn mowing shoes as it affects safety and performance while mowing.

  • Outsole Material: The material of the outsole greatly influences traction, with rubber being the most common choice for its grip on various surfaces.
  • Tread Pattern: A shoe’s tread pattern determines how well it can grip the ground; deeper and more aggressive patterns provide better traction on uneven or slippery terrains.
  • Water Resistance: Shoes that are water-resistant or waterproof can prevent slips caused by wet grass, ensuring better stability while mowing.
  • Weight Distribution: Shoes designed with good weight distribution can enhance balance and reduce the likelihood of slips during mowing activities.
  • Comfort and Fit: A well-fitting shoe allows for better control and traction, as loose shoes can lead to instability, increasing the risk of accidents.

Outsole Material: The material of the outsole greatly influences traction, with rubber being the most common choice for its grip on various surfaces. Shoes with a durable rubber outsole not only provide excellent traction but also resist wear from continuous contact with grass and soil.

Tread Pattern: A shoe’s tread pattern determines how well it can grip the ground; deeper and more aggressive patterns provide better traction on uneven or slippery terrains. Tread features such as lugs or grooves help to channel water away and enhance grip, making them particularly useful when mowing on wet grass.

Water Resistance: Shoes that are water-resistant or waterproof can prevent slips caused by wet grass, ensuring better stability while mowing. This feature is essential for maintaining grip and comfort, especially during early morning mowing when dew is present.

Weight Distribution: Shoes designed with good weight distribution can enhance balance and reduce the likelihood of slips during mowing activities. A well-balanced shoe helps keep the foot stable and allows for more confident movement across varying lawn conditions.

Comfort and Fit: A well-fitting shoe allows for better control and traction, as loose shoes can lead to instability, increasing the risk of accidents. Properly fitted shoes also reduce fatigue, allowing the wearer to mow for longer periods without discomfort.

Why Is Breathability Important in Lawn Mowing Footwear?

Breathability is a crucial factor in selecting lawn mowing footwear for several reasons that significantly impact comfort and performance during yard work.

  • Temperature Regulation: Lawn mowing often occurs in warm weather, where prolonged foot exposure can lead to overheating. Breathable materials help dissipate heat, keeping your feet cool and comfortable.

  • Moisture Management: Grass and dirt can introduce moisture during mowing. Shoes made from breathable fabrics allow sweat and moisture to escape, reducing the risk of blisters and fungal infections caused by trapped moisture.

  • Comfort: Breathable footwear enhances overall comfort. When feet can breathe, there’s less likelihood of fatigue, allowing users to mow larger areas without discomfort.

  • Odor Control: Good ventilation reduces moisture buildup, which minimizes unpleasant odors. This is especially important for those who mow frequently or for extended periods.

  • Improved Grip and Stability: Some breathable shoes incorporate advanced traction features. Proper airflow prevents the feet from slipping, ensuring better grip on wet or uneven surfaces typically found in lawns.

Choosing shoes specifically designed for breathability ensures a more enjoyable and efficient mowing experience.

What Materials Should Your Best Lawn Mowing Shoe Be Made Of?

The best lawn mowing shoes should be made of materials that provide comfort, durability, and protection.

  • Leather: Leather is a popular choice for lawn mowing shoes due to its durability and resistance to wear and tear. It provides a good level of protection against sharp objects like sticks and stones, and it can also be water-resistant, keeping your feet dry in wet conditions.
  • Rubber: Rubber soles are essential for lawn mowing shoes as they offer excellent traction on grassy and uneven surfaces. They help prevent slipping and provide stability while walking on wet grass, making them a safe option for mowing enthusiasts.
  • Mesh: Shoes that incorporate mesh materials are ideal for hot weather, as they allow for breathability and ventilation. This keeps your feet cool and comfortable during long mowing sessions, reducing sweat and discomfort.
  • Foam Padding: Foam padding in the shoe’s insole and collar enhances comfort, especially during extended use. It helps absorb impact and provides cushioning, making it easier to walk and maneuver while mowing the lawn.
  • Waterproof Fabrics: Waterproof materials are beneficial to keep your feet dry in case of dew or wet grass. This feature is especially important for early morning mowing or in rainy climates, where moisture can otherwise lead to discomfort and potential foot issues.

How Do Lawn Mowing Shoes Differ from Regular Sneakers?

The best lawn mowing shoes are specifically designed to enhance comfort, safety, and performance while mowing grass compared to regular sneakers.

  • Material: Lawn mowing shoes are typically made from durable, weather-resistant materials that can withstand exposure to grass, moisture, and potential chemicals from fertilizers or pesticides.
  • Traction: These shoes feature specialized soles with deep treads to provide better grip on wet or uneven surfaces, reducing the risk of slips and falls during mowing.
  • Support: Lawn mowing shoes often include additional arch and heel support to ensure that users can stand comfortably for extended periods, which is essential during long mowing sessions.
  • Protection: Many lawn mowing shoes come with reinforced toes and other protective elements to safeguard the feet from potential hazards like falling tools, sharp objects, or heavy equipment.
  • Breathability: These shoes are designed with ventilation features to keep feet cool and dry, preventing discomfort from heat and moisture buildup while working outdoors.

The material used in lawn mowing shoes is crucial, as they are often constructed from synthetic or treated leather that resists water and stains, ensuring longevity and cleanliness even after frequent use. In contrast, regular sneakers may not provide the same level of resistance, leading to quicker wear and potential damage when exposed to grass and soil.

Traction is vital for safety during mowing, which is why lawn mowing shoes are equipped with rubber soles that have aggressive tread patterns. This design helps maintain stability on various terrains, unlike standard sneakers that may have smoother soles, making them less suitable for mowing tasks.

Support is another significant factor; lawn mowing shoes usually come with cushioned insoles and ergonomic designs that promote comfort and reduce fatigue, allowing users to walk and stand on their feet for hours. Regular sneakers often lack this level of specialized support, which can result in discomfort during prolonged activities.

Protection is enhanced in lawn mowing shoes through features such as reinforced toe caps or steel toe options, which shield feet from potential injuries. Regular sneakers generally lack this additional layer of safety, making them less ideal for yard work where unexpected hazards may occur.

Lastly, breathability is a key aspect since lawn mowing shoes often incorporate mesh panels or moisture-wicking materials that facilitate airflow and moisture management. Regular sneakers may not offer the same breathability, which can lead to sweaty, uncomfortable feet during hot weather or extended use.
